Main Settings
Menu start
Selects a first-displayed menu from the top menu or
the last menu screen.
(Top/Previous)
MOVIE Button
Sets whether or not to activate the MOVIE button.
(On/Off)
Custom Key Settings
Assigns functions to the soft keys or the right side of
the control wheel.
(Soft key B Setting/Right Key Setting/Custom)
Beep
Selects the sound produced when you operate the
camera.
(On/Off)
Language
Selects the language used on the screen.
Date/Time Setup
Sets the date and time.
Area Setting
Selects the area where you are using the camera.
Help Guide Display
Turns the Help Guide on or off.
(On/Off)
Power Save
Sets the level of the power saving feature.
(Max/Standard)
Power Saving Start
Time
Sets the time to turn the camera to the power save
mode.
(30 Min/5 Min/1 Min/20 Sec/10 Sec)
LCD Brightness
Sets the brightness of the LCD screen.
(Manual/Sunny Weather)
Display Color
Selects the color of the LCD screen.
(Black/White/Blue/Pink)
Wide Image
Selects a method to display wide images.
(Full Screen/Normal)
Playback Display
Selects the method used to play back portrait images.
(Auto Rotate/Manual Rotate)
HDMI Resolution
Set resolution when connected to HDMI TV.
(Auto/1080p/1080i)
CTRL FOR HDMI
Sets whether or not to operate the camera with a
“BRAVIA” Sync-compliant TV’s Remote Control.
(On/Off)
USB Connection
Selects the appropriate USB connection method for
each computer or USB device connected to the
camera.
(Auto/Mass Storage/MTP)
